Preparing for Your Removals in Earlsfield

Preparation makes a huge difference to how a move feels. Even if you have booked professional help, the smoother your own organisation is, the easier the day will be. This does not mean you have to do everything yourself; it simply means taking care of a few important tasks ahead of time so that the removals team can work efficiently once they arrive.

Useful preparation checklist:

  • Sort through belongings and remove items you no longer need
  • Pack non-essential items well before moving day
  • Label boxes by room and note fragile contents clearly
  • Keep important documents, valuables, and essentials separate
  • Defrost and clean appliances in advance if they are being moved
  • Measure large furniture against doorways and stairs where possible
  • Make arrangements for pets and young children on moving day
  • Reserve access or parking if your building requires it

It also helps to pack an essentials box with kettle items, chargers, toiletries, medication, snacks, and basic cleaning products. That way, when you arrive at the new property, you will have the things you need immediately without having to search through multiple boxes. A little planning now can save a lot of stress later.

Office relocation setup with boxes and equipment for Earlsfield commercial removals Pricing Factors for Removals in Earlsfield

Customers often want to know what affects the cost of a removal, and that is a sensible question. While exact prices vary from move to move, there are several common factors that influence the quote. Understanding these points helps you compare services more fairly and choose the right level of support for your situation.

Common pricing factors include:

  • The size of the property and volume of belongings
  • Whether the move is local, regional, or further afield
  • Access conditions at both properties
  • The number of movers required
  • Whether packing materials and packing services are needed
  • Furniture dismantling or reassembly
  • The timing of the move and how much flexibility is needed
  • Any special handling for fragile, heavy, or awkward items

In Earlsfield, access can be a particularly important part of the discussion. If the property has limited parking, a narrow street, a shared entrance, or awkward loading conditions, the move may take more time and planning than a simple driveway-to-driveway job. That does not mean the process has to be complicated; it just means the removals team should know what they are working with before the day arrives. A clear, honest quote is always more useful than a vague estimate that does not reflect the real conditions of the move.

Special Items and Careful Handling

Not everything in a move is standard. Many households and businesses have items that require extra care, and a good removals service should be ready to handle them thoughtfully. This might include glass tables, mirrors, antiques, musical instruments, office equipment, large wardrobes, or unusually shaped furniture. The goal is always to protect the item and make sure it travels safely.

Some items may need to be wrapped separately, padded more heavily, or carried by multiple people. Others may need to be dismantled before moving and rebuilt at the destination. If you know in advance that you have awkward or valuable pieces, it is best to mention them early so the team can plan appropriately. The same applies if your property includes tight staircases, narrow door frames, or limited turning space.

Extra care can also be useful for:

  • TVs and entertainment systems
  • Glassware and crockery
  • Artwork and framed pieces
  • Home office equipment
  • Garden items and outdoor furniture
  • Bulky fitness equipment

FAQ: Removals in Earlsfield

How far in advance should I book a removal?
It is usually sensible to book as soon as your moving date is known, especially during busy periods. Earlsfield moves can be popular because many people are relocating within the surrounding south-west London area, so early booking gives you better choice and more time to prepare.

Can you help if I am moving from a flat with stairs only?
Yes, moves involving stairs are common and can usually be planned for. It is helpful to mention stair access when you enquire so the team can plan the right approach and allocate enough time and labour.

Do you handle office and business removals as well as home moves?
Yes, many local removal services support both residential and commercial customers. Office moves, studio relocations, and business equipment transport all require careful organisation, and a local team can help keep downtime low.

What should I tell the removals team before moving day?
Share details about access, parking, lifts, stairs, fragile items, dismantling needs, and any tight timing constraints. The more accurate the information, the easier it is to plan the move properly.

Can I get help with packing?
Many customers prefer to use packing support for some or all of their belongings. This can be especially useful for fragile items, busy households, or larger moves where time is limited.

What if I only need help with the heavy furniture?
That is often possible. Some moves only need transport and lifting support for larger items, while the customer handles smaller boxes themselves. It depends on the service options available and the size of your move.
